Elderly Age Dependency Ratio: The number of persons aged 65 or over per 100 persons in the population aged 15
through 64 years.
Percent Elderly: The percent of total population comprised of persons aged 65 and over.
Total Age Dependency Ratio: The number of children under 15 years of age plus the number of persons aged 65 and
over per 100 persons in the population aged 15 through 64 years.
Child Age Dependency Ratio: The number of children under 15 years of age per 100 persons in the population aged 15
through 64 years.

Number of Households: The number of occupied houses, apartments, or other separate living quarters, in which the occupants
live and eat separately from other persons in the building and to which they have direct access from outside the building or through
a common hall.

Children Receiving Special Education Services: Unduplicated counts of children age 0-20 years receiving
special education services provided by the public school system.
WIC Participants - Unduplicated Counts: The total number of pregnant, post-partum and nursing women,
infants and children less than 5 years of age who received WIC vouchers. County level data are determined by
combining unduplicated participants of all clinics within a county's boundaries. State total does not equal the
sum of the counties because participants may move counties during the year.

MFIP-MA (Minnesota Family Investment Program - Medical Assistance): Medical Assistance eligibility is based on receipt
of cash assistance from MFIP. Counts include both fee-for-service and HMO enrollees.
GAMC (General Assistance Medical Care): Most enrollees are eligible on a medical-only basis; fewer than one-third are
eligible based on receipt of cash assistance from General Assistance. Counts include both fee-for-service and HMO enrollees.

Medical Assistance: This category excludes MFIP-MA enrollees. Enrollees over age 21 may be eligible as parents or based
on disability. Those eligible as disabled may be SSI recipients. Counts include both fee-for-service and HMO enrollees and
non-citizen Medical Assistance recipients.
MinnesotaCare: MinnesotaCare children and pregnant women are Medicaid eligible under a waiver. MinnesotaCare coverage
is provided under HMO arrangements.
